MapPlano borrador del límite comun á las dos Floridas y de los territorios de ambas provincias adyacentes á el. Shows region between Santa Rosa Bay and Apalache Bay. Depths shown by soundings. Pen-and-ink and pencil. Has watermark. From the papers of Vicente Sebastián Pintado. Described in: Vicente Sebastián Pintado, Surveyor General of Spanish West Florida, 1805-17 : the man and his maps / by John R. Hébert. Imago mundi, v. 39, pp. 50-72. 1987. p. 70, no. 51. Includes explanatory notes. LC Luso-Hispanic...

MapDescripcion de la Bahia de Santa Maria de Galve, y Puerto de Sn. Miguel de Panzacola con toda la costa contigua y las demas bahias que tiene en ella, hasta el Rio ... Covers coast of western Florida Panhandle from Pensacola to Apalachicola. Depths shown by soundings. Prime meridian: Terceira Island, Azores [?]. Pen-and-ink and orange watercolor. Includes notes. Imperfect: Wrinkled, stained, and creased. LC Luso-Hispanic world, 870 LC Nautical charts on vellum, 22 Available also through the Library of Congress Web site as a raster image.

Map[Map of Spanish East and West Florida from Mobile Bay to Apalache Bay bounded by the United States boundary on the north]. Depths shown by soundings. Place names in Spanish. Title from John R. Hébert's list of maps. Pen-and-ink and pencil; unfinished. From the papers of Vicente Sebastián Pintado. Described in: Vicente Sebastián Pintado, Surveyor General of Spanish West Florida, 1805-17 : the man and his maps / by John R. Hébert. Imago mundi, v. 39, pp. 50-72. 1987. p. 63, no. 12. Includes explanatory note....
